A woman in a dream generally represents worldly life (*dunya*), secrets, or prosperity. If one sees a beautiful woman, it signifies good fortune, ease, and increased *rizq* (sustenance). However, an ugly or unpleasant woman indicates difficulty, hardship, or a trial of faith. This interpretation stems from the association of women with the allurements and comforts of this world, both potentially beneficial and spiritually distracting. The concept of *fitna* (trial or temptation) is also relevant, as a woman's presence can test one's devotion.

If one sees a veiled or pious lady engaged in acts of worship ( *ibadah*) such as *salat* (prayer), it signifies guidance, righteousness, and an increase in faith. The veil (*hijab*) itself symbolizes protection from worldly temptations and a dedication to Allah. If the lady is reciting Quran or giving *sadaqah* (charity), it foretells good deeds and spiritual advancement. Conversely, a lady neglecting religious duties suggests a need to strengthen one's own faith and avoid negligence.

The appearance of a "Lady" in a dream within the Hindu tradition often signifies Shakti, the divine feminine energy that underpins the universe. This energy represents creativity, dynamism, and transformation rather than simple gender. If the lady appears radiant and benevolent, it can represent the influence of Prakriti, the primordial substance of the material world, indicating themes of creation and change. This presence calls the dreamer to acknowledge and integrate feminine qualities within themselves.

Seeing a Lady embodying compassion, mercy, and protection can signify Guanyin, the Bodhisattva of Compassion. This implies divine intervention and the dreamer's need for compassion, both for self and others. It is a sign to seek guidance, and trust in protection from external malevolent influences. The dream signals a time for introspection and cultivating kindness.
